Magneto
1/9/09 - Ian McKellan said he was meeting with The Hobbit director Guillermo del Toro on Thursday to discuss reprising his Lord of the Rings role of Gandalf the wizard in the prequel, based on J.R.R. Tolkien's book. Preproduction on The Hobbit is underway. "I've been promised I am going to be involved," McKellan said. "And as Guillermo del Toro's directing it, I should be so lucky. And in New Zealand, a place I love, so it's almost an ideal job for me." Meanwhile, McKellan said that he has not seen a script yet for the proposed X-Men spinoff film featuring his character, Magneto. David Goyer has written a script, but it has not made it to the actor yet. "I haven't read a script, no," McKellan said. "It's not come my way. I'm here and ready and waiting, but I think if they do do a spinoff of Magneto, it'll be about the young man, the young Magneto." The success of the upcoming prequel film X-Men Origins: Wolverine, which stars Hugh Jackman, could determine Magneto's prospects.
05/15/08 – There’s been a recent report of a picture depicting a young Beast in the upcoming X-Men spinoff film Magneto. The report stated that the figure in the picture had a tail, leading readers to suspect that it might have been Nightcrawler and not the Beast, but a representative from a creature development shop is on record identifying the character as the Beast and confirming that he will be in Magneto.
12/31/06 - David Goyer will direct the X-Men spinoff movie that will center on the villain Magneto. Magneto comes to grips with his mutant ability to manipulate metal objects as he and his parents try to survive in Auschwitz. Magneto meets Professor Xavier when the latter is a soldier liberating the concentration camp. Magneto hones his powers by hunting down and killing Nazi war criminals who tortured him, and his lust for vengeance turns Xavier and Magneto into enemies. Both characters will be played by actors in their 20s.
